Skip to main content

Eldorado Do Sul, Brazil

Principal Software Engineer

Brasil; Sao Paulo, Brazil

Aplicar agora

Conforme avaliado por funcionários atuais e ex-funcionários

IT Principal Software Engineer

AI Acceleration platform team is all about breaking new ground to enable & equip our customers to generate sophisticated new insights and provide solutions to the business challenges. Our mission is to develop a whole new approach to generating meaning and value from petabyte-scale data sets and shape brand new methodologies, tools, and models under our own Dell AI/ML Platform including Generative AI large language model solutions for Dell Technologies.

Join us to do the best work of your career and make a profound social impact as a IT Principal Software Engineer on our Software Engineer-IT Team in Brazil (Eldorado do Sul/RS or São Paulo/SP) on hybrid work mode.


What you’ll achieve
As an IT Principal Software Engineer, you will deliver products and improvements for a changing world. Working at the cutting edge, you will craft and develop software for platforms, peripherals, applications and diagnostics — all with the most sophisticated technologies, tools, software engineering methodologies and partnerships.

This position will merge software engineering, modern dev ops, data engineering and deployment at scale to help teams deploy algorithmic models that can optimize business and customer experiences at scale.  The candidate will use technical knowledge and software development to build technology centric solutions for data as a service and will help accelerate the data solutions offering for all generative and traditional AI use cases for across Dell technologies.


You will:
• Lead changes in architectural direction, methodology or programming procedures, customer engagements, mentoring of developers, large projects that affect the organizations long-term goals and objectives

• Innovate through advanced research and development in the fields of Large Language Models (LLMs), Generative AI, Deep Learning, implementing, and fine-tuning architectures using frameworks like PyTorch and TensorFlow to tackle complex ML problems.

Utilize a range of applicable technologies (e.g SME level knowledge in programming languages,  data structures & problem solving skills other tools) for products used in local, networked, storage enhancements and/or new systems.

• Participate in product development in all stages from planning and design to development, testing, deployment and documentation.

• Define detailed workflows for corresponding use cases involved in Generative AI Projects and provide consulting and guidance to functions with developing strategic priorities and structure Business problems, including through business problem scoping workshops and driving documentation of as-is to be mapping



Take the first step towards your dream career

Every Dell Technologies team member brings something unique to the table. Here’s what we are looking for with this role:


Essential Requirements

  • Ability to apply extensive knowledge of application programming languages like Java, .NET, Python and databases (Postgres, Vector & Graph databases)
  • Understanding of generative AI capabilities like Large Language Model , knowledge of Embeddings & vector similarities & foundational knowledge of RAG model for information retrieval.
  • Experience with DevOps, Security tools, scans and vulnerability remediation (Gitlab, Synk,). Experience with Cloud Native Container platforms like Kubernetes, Container on Base Metal and Linux/Windows Server Operating Systems
  • Experience in building API platforms and advanced knowledge of automated testing tools and procedures
  • Advanced English level

Desirable Requirements

  • Bachelor’s degree in computing engineering or computer science


Who we are

We believe that each of us has the power to make an impact. That’s why we put our team members at the center of everything we do. If you’re looking for an opportunity to grow your career with some of the best minds and most advanced tech in the industry, we’re looking for you.

Dell Technologies is a unique family of businesses that helps individuals and organizations transform how they work, live and play. Join us to build a future that works for everyone because Progress Takes All of Us.

Application closing date: 24 May 2024

Dell Technologies is committed to the principle of equal employment opportunity for all employees and to providing employees with a work environment free of discrimination and harassment. Read the full Equal Employment Opportunity Policy here.

Job ID:R243479

Dell’s Flexible & Hybrid Work Culture

At Dell Technologies, we believe our best work is done when flexibility is offered.

We know that freedom and flexibility are crucial to all our employees no matter where you are located and our flexible and hybrid work style allows team members to have the freedom to ideate, be innovative, and drive results their way. To learn more about our work culture, please visit our locations page.

Aplicar agora

Por que trabalhar aqui

Benefícios Globais

  • Programas de Saúde

  • Ferramentas e Recursos Premiados de Bem-Estar Financeiro

  • Licença-maternidade e paternidade generosa, para novas mães, pais, cuidadoras e cuidadores

  • Plataforma de bem-estar líder no setor

  • Programa de Assistência para as Pessoas da nossa Equipe

Seja a primeira pessoa a receber novas vagas

Registre-se e receba alertas de vagas

Inscreva-se e receba oportunidades que combinem com suas habilidades, diretamente no seu email.

Career Level

*Campo obrigatório

Interessado emSelecione uma categoria de emprego e/ou localização, e clique em "Adicionar" para cada pesquisa salva. Finalmente, clique em "cadastrar" para criar o alerta de vaga.

  • Tecnologia da informação - TI, São Paulo, São Paulo, BrasilExcluir
  • Graduados, São Paulo, São Paulo, BrasilExcluir
  • TI, São Paulo, São Paulo, BrasilExcluir
  • Engenharia, São Paulo, São Paulo, BrasilExcluir